    Abstract: An object of the present invention is to provide an anti-tumor agent that exhibits a remarkably excellent anti-tumor effect. According to the present invention, there is provided an anti-tumor agent for curing cancer, the anti-tumor agent having a liposome which has an inner water phase and having an aqueous solution which is an outer water phase and disperses the liposome, in which the liposome encompasses topotecan or a salt thereof, a lipid constituting the liposome contains a lipid modified with polyethylene glycol, dihydrosphingomyelin, and cholesterol, the inner water phase contains an ammonium salt, and the topotecan or the salt thereof encompassed in the liposome is administered at a dose rate of 0.1 mg/m2 body surface area to 10 mg/m2 body surface area, in terms of topotecan per administration.

    Abstract: A method for manufacturing a positive electrode material of a solid-state battery, the method includes a first mixing to mix a positive electrode active material with a conductive aid to generate a first powder, a second mixing to mix a solid electrolyte with the conductive aid to generate a second powder, and a third mixing to mix the first powder with the second powder to generate a third powder. According to the method, it is possible to reduce the amount of a dispersion medium when generating a slurry in manufacturing the positive electrode material.

    Abstract: An object is to provide a method for manufacturing an electrode composite slurry and a manufacturing device which can continuously manufacture an electrode composite slurry and suppress the production of faulty products. A method for continuously manufacturing a secondary cell electrode composite slurry is provided, and the method includes: a dispersing-kneading step of continuously dispersing and kneading the material of the electrode composite slurry; a first property measurement step of measuring the property of the electrode composite slurry that has been dispersed and kneaded; a redispersing-kneading step of redispersing and kneading the electrode composite slurry; and a property determination step of determining whether or not the redispersing-kneading step is performed based on the result of the measurement in the first property measurement step.

    Abstract: An information communication device is provided with a monitoring unit, a communication unit, a storage unit, a switching unit, an acquisition unit, a creation unit, and a transmission unit. In the event that the monitoring unit detects trouble in the basic network, the switching unit switches the communication function of the communication unit from a first communication function to a second communication function. In the event that the monitoring unit detects trouble in the basic network, the creation unit creates notification information about the trouble in the basic network. The transmission unit transmits the created notification information via the switched-to communication function to a contact retrieved from the storage unit.
